Disturbances in tooth formation

K00.4 is the ICD-10-CM code for Disturbances in tooth formation. It is a billable, specific code valid for reimbursement.

K00-K95 Diseases of the digestive system

Includes

  • Aplasia and hypoplasia of cementum
  • Dilaceration of tooth
  • Enamel hypoplasia (neonatal) (postnatal) (prenatal)
  • Regional odontodysplasia
  • Turner's tooth

Excludes1 — not coded here

  • Hutchinson's teeth and mulberry molars in congenital syphilis (A50.5)
